Understanding Efficiency Ratings

The efficiency rating of a solar cell is one of the most significant factors affecting its overall performance. Higher efficiency means more electricity generation from the same amount of sunlight, which is vital, particularly in regions with limited space for installation. Customers should look for mono solar cells with efficiency ratings above 20%, as this standard typically reflects advanced technology and better materials.

Comparing Technology Types

Not all mono solar cells are created equal. There are different technologies used in the manufacturing process, such as PERC (Passivated Emitter and Rear Cell) and Bifacial designs. PERC cells enhance efficiency by reflecting light back into the cell, while bifacial cells capture sunlight on both sides, increasing energy production. End customers must assess the specific needs of their projects to select the technology that provides the best balance of efficiency and cost.

Durability and Warranty Considerations

Durability plays a vital role in the long-term success of solar installations. End customers should look for mono solar cells with robust construction that can withstand environmental stresses, including high winds, hail, and extreme temperatures. A minimum warranty period of 25 years is advisable; this not only indicates the manufacturer’s confidence in their product but also assures customers of long-term performance.

Performance in Diverse Conditions

Different geographical locations present unique challenges for solar installations. Therefore, selecting mono solar cells that maintain performance in various weather conditions is essential. Researching product certifications, such as IEC 61215 and IEC 61730, can provide customers with insights into how well the cells perform under different environmental scenarios.

Cost-Effectiveness and Return on Investment

While it’s tempting to choose the lowest-priced option, end customers should consider total cost of ownership when selecting mono solar cells. Initial costs should be weighed against efficiency, durability, and energy output over time. Conducting a thorough cost-benefit analysis ensures customers can match their investment with expected returns, maximizing profitability in the long run.

Supply Chain and Availability

End customers must also factor in the reliability of supply chains when considering mono solar cells for exports. Inconsistencies in availability can lead to project delays and increased costs. Collaborating with manufacturers who have a solid reputation for meeting delivery timelines can enhance the overall project experience.

Regulatory Compliance and Certifications

Exporting solar products often involves navigating complex regulatory landscapes. Customers should ensure that the mono solar cells they choose comply with local regulations and have the necessary certifications, which can vary by region. Compliance not only facilitates smoother exports but also assures potential customers of the product's quality and safety.
